Overnight Flagging Operation on S.R. 29 over the Caloosahatchee River from 9 p.m. to 6 a.m. for Bridge Maintenance
HENDRY COUNTY, Fla. – The Florida Department of Transportation (FDOT) District One will begin overnight lane closures on the State Road 29 LaBelle drawbridge over the Caloosahatchee River beginning on Monday, June 15, at 9 p.m. This work will continue through 6:00 a.m., Tuesday, June 16. One lane will be open at all times as crews conduct maintenance and repairs to the underside of the bridge deck.
Motorists can expect flaggers to be present during this overnight work. Pedestrians and bicyclists will be escorted through the work zone as needed.
Motorists may wish to make alternate plans or allow for extra travel time during the bridge deck maintenance and repair.
